15 Sample Cover Letters for Office Assistant


Getting a job as an office assistant starts with making a good first impression. Your cover letter acts as your introduction to potential employers. A well-written cover letter can make you stand out from other candidates and show why you are perfect for the job.

This article gives you 15 different cover letter examples for office assistant positions. Each one is written to help you get noticed by hiring managers and land that all-important interview. Keep reading to see how you can create your own winning cover letter.

1. Basic Office Assistant Cover Letter

January 15, 2025

Sarah Johnson
123 Main Street
Anytown, ST 12345
Phone: (555) 123-4567
Email: sarah.johnson@email.com

Mr. David Williams
Hiring Manager
ABC Company
456 Business Avenue
Anytown, ST 12345


Subject: Application for Office Assistant Position

Dear Mr. Williams,

Please accept my application for the Office Assistant position at ABC Company that was posted on JobSearch.com. With five years of administrative experience and strong organizational skills, I am eager to bring my talents to your team.

My background includes managing calendars, coordinating meetings, handling correspondence, and maintaining filing systems. I am proficient in Microsoft Office Suite and have experience with various office equipment. My previous supervisor often praised my attention to detail and ability to work efficiently under pressure.

I would appreciate the opportunity to discuss how my skills align with your needs. Thank you for considering my application. I look forward to hearing from you.


Sincerely,

Sarah Johnson

8. Remote Office Assistant Cover Letter

August 10, 2025

Daniel Thompson
321 Digital Lane
Techville, ST 13579
Phone: (555) 789-0123
Email: dthompson@email.com

Ms. Rachel Wong
Remote Team Leader
Virtual Business Solutions
Online Headquarters
Techville, ST 13579

Subject: Application for Remote Office Assistant Position

Dear Ms. Wong,

After reading your job posting for a Remote Office Assistant on RemoteJobs.com, I am excited to submit my application. With four years of experience working in virtual administrative roles, I have developed the self-discipline, communication skills, and technical abilities needed to excel in this position.

Working remotely has taught me the importance of clear communication, proactive problem-solving, and effective time management. In my current virtual assistant role with Digital Enterprises, I handle email correspondence, maintain digital filing systems, schedule meetings across multiple time zones, and prepare reports using cloud-based applications. I am proficient in remote collaboration tools including Zoom, Microsoft Teams, Slack, Asana, and Google Workspace. My home office is fully equipped with high-speed internet, backup power, and all necessary technology to ensure uninterrupted service.

Thank you for considering my application. I would welcome the opportunity to discuss how my remote work experience could benefit Virtual Business Solutions.

Sincerely,

Daniel Thompson

Wrap-up: Cover Letters that Get Results

Writing an effective cover letter takes practice, but using the right format and showcasing your relevant skills can significantly improve your chances of landing an interview. Each of the sample letters above highlights different strengths and situations that might apply to your job search.

When writing your own cover letter, make sure to customize it for each position you apply for. Focus on the specific skills and experiences that match the job description. Keep your letter concise, professional, and free of spelling or grammar errors.

With these examples as your guide, you can create a compelling cover letter that helps you stand out from other candidates and takes you one step closer to securing your ideal office assistant position. Good luck with your job search!
